VANCOUVER – The UBC Thunderbirds hit the court this weekend at War Memorial Gym for the
West Coast Classic. The exhibition tournament features six teams from Canada West (UBC, Mt. Royal, MacEwan, Trinity Western, Thompson Rivers, Alberta) and two teams from the OUA (Western, Ryerson).
UBC Head Coach
Doug Reimer and his 2016-17 edition of the UBC Thunderbirds are getting a look at some of the teams who will be standing between them and a national championship in 2017.
The 'Birds started the tournament on Friday with a gritty 3-2 (25-16, 27-25, 10-25, 21-25, 16-14) win over Mt. Royal, then followed that up with a 3-1 (25-19, 22-25, 25-13, 25-19) win over MacEwan on Saturday afternoon.
This set UBC up for a rematch of the 2016 CIS semi-final with their regional rival Trinity Western Spartans. The 'Birds dropped a tough 3-1 (25-18, 25-23, 18-25, 25-17) decision to TWU.
UBC will play Mount Royal for the bronze medal Sunday, October 16th at 11:45am at War Memorial Gym.
